Skip to content

Switch from cssutils to tinycss2 and fork of ujson5#84

Merged
domdfcoding merged 13 commits into
masterfrom
new-parser
May 8, 2026
Merged

Switch from cssutils to tinycss2 and fork of ujson5#84
domdfcoding merged 13 commits into
masterfrom
new-parser

Conversation

@domdfcoding
Copy link
Copy Markdown
Member

Replaces cssutils as the parser/emitter. tinycss2 is now used to parse files, and a slimmed down modified copy of ujson5 is used to emit CSS.

@repo-helper repo-helper Bot added failure: docs The docs check is failing. failure: mypy The mypy check is failing. failure: Linux The Linux tests are failing. failure: Windows The Windows tests are failing. failure: flake8 The Flake8 check is failing. and removed failure: mypy The mypy check is failing. failure: Windows The Windows tests are failing. failure: Linux The Linux tests are failing. labels May 7, 2026
@repo-helper repo-helper Bot removed failure: flake8 The Flake8 check is failing. failure: mypy The mypy check is failing. failure: Linux The Linux tests are failing. failure: docs The docs check is failing. failure: Windows The Windows tests are failing. labels May 8, 2026
@domdfcoding domdfcoding merged commit 58b0185 into master May 8, 2026
64 of 65 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ant